Vincent Van Gogh : The Cormon workshop

When Vincent heard about that well-known Parisian workshop, famous for the quality of its courses and its liberal side, he wanted to go there. It was one of the important reasons which hurried his going to Paris.
Many of the neo-Impressionnists went to that workshop. Vincent met Toulouse-Lautrec, then Anquetin and Bernard, who became his friends, there.
